Commit Graph

  • fcafde2d0f Change if with 2 `Text`s to 1 `Text` with ternary inside krawieck 2020-08-30 19:31:55 +0200
  • 91aada67e9 Remove '@' from '@TODO:' krawieck 2020-08-30 19:29:12 +0200
  • c56c8e34f3 Update pubspec.yaml krawieck 2020-08-30 18:54:51 +0200
  • e673eac152 Add handlink links in markdown and general link launcher krawieck 2020-08-30 16:49:59 +0200
  • 8275dd1086 Bump `lemmy_api_client` version krawieck 2020-08-30 16:39:32 +0200
  • 8c68c17308 Add markdown support for post krawieck 2020-08-29 22:50:37 +0200
  • 015a29435b Restruture `post.dart` to be more sane krawieck 2020-08-29 21:01:01 +0200
  • 9fabb75676 fix overflow for number of comments krawieck 2020-08-29 20:31:53 +0200
  • 697bbf4e9c Bump `lemmy_api_client` and revise imports krawieck 2020-08-28 13:47:52 +0200
  • e107fb6cc6 Rename `components` to `widgets` krawieck 2020-08-28 13:45:03 +0200
  • 10cc96d23a Move actions to separate functions. still not implemented krawieck 2020-08-28 13:30:42 +0200
  • 6cfeef57a7 Update pubspec krawieck 2020-08-27 23:28:41 +0200
  • 2cba79e689 Add basic post component krawieck 2020-08-27 23:27:27 +0200
  • fc81c1ad26
    Merge pull request #11 from krawieck/http-client Filip Krawczyk 2020-08-21 13:45:35 +0200
  • b19e7d50fa fix lints #11 shilangyu 2020-08-21 00:37:51 +0000
  • bbc27a3715
    Merge branch 'master' into http-client Marcin Wojnarowski 2020-08-20 22:30:58 +0000
  • 20d7790609 Update pubspec.lock krawieck 2020-08-21 00:28:00 +0200
  • 76b5067487 Merge branch 'http-client' of https://github.com/krawieck/lemmur into http-client krawieck 2020-08-21 00:27:06 +0200
  • 9e1333e462 removed migrated code (now at krawieck/lemmy_api_client) shilangyu 2020-08-21 00:22:24 +0000
  • 26b0894943 Update pubspec.lock krawieck 2020-08-21 00:26:32 +0200
  • 8720272ee5 Implement 3 endpoints and add 1 model krawieck 2020-08-18 23:38:57 +0200
  • eeac5af15e Add 3 endpoints related to communities and 1 model krawieck 2020-08-18 22:22:56 +0200
  • f3329b82ff Update `register` method to be compliant with the docs krawieck 2020-08-14 16:43:42 +0200
  • be71efd3c1 Implement `getPost` krawieck 2020-08-14 15:47:23 +0200
  • e464a0b922 Implement `getReplies` krawieck 2020-08-14 14:41:35 +0200
  • 177b6ea712 Add a bunch of `assert`s krawieck 2020-08-14 14:13:44 +0200
  • 705b90148e Implement `getUserDetails` krawieck 2020-08-14 13:49:20 +0200
  • 05caba277e Implement `login` (`POST /user/login`) krawieck 2020-08-14 00:34:09 +0200
  • cfae9ba373 Change double quotes to single quotes cuz i want linter to STFU krawieck 2020-08-14 00:24:41 +0200
  • 7ea2168d47 finished tests for all LemmyAPI.v1 client shilangyu 2020-08-14 00:12:41 +0200
  • c90a3bdd73 Make second argument in `get` optional krawieck 2020-08-14 00:10:46 +0200
  • cbd6a208d3 Implement `listCategories` (`GET /categories`) krawieck 2020-08-13 23:56:00 +0200
  • 5e15ddd7bd Implement `search` method (`GET /search`) krawieck 2020-08-13 23:32:41 +0200
  • 8310db4294 Exclude codegen (`*.g.dart`) files krawieck 2020-08-13 20:49:24 +0200
  • 92d684cbfd Change strings to single quotes krawieck 2020-08-13 20:25:48 +0200
  • 120c7554c8 additional linting rules shilangyu 2020-08-13 19:37:59 +0200
  • 9a9a66cd17 tests for main.dart shilangyu 2020-08-13 16:32:02 +0200
  • 9c9de8c41d changed abstract class to mixin shilangyu 2020-08-13 16:18:33 +0200
  • 506b007eea implemented get/post helpers shilangyu 2020-08-13 15:39:53 +0200
  • 946e77bfdd getPosts tests shilangyu 2020-08-12 21:01:33 +0200
  • a0002d0eb6 move model tests to a separate folder shilangyu 2020-08-12 21:01:13 +0200
  • 141b929661 export enums as well shilangyu 2020-08-12 21:00:31 +0200
  • b433bf0971 Add more `assert`s for checking required props krawieck 2020-08-12 11:55:26 +0200
  • 1307b5e5b1 Add `assert`s for checking required props krawieck 2020-08-12 11:53:17 +0200
  • f68467708a yet another imports cleanup krawieck 2020-08-11 19:54:38 +0200
  • be3bd569f4 Replace `type_` with `type` krawieck 2020-08-11 19:54:12 +0200
  • 4a096602b5 Fix up imports krawieck 2020-08-11 19:32:13 +0200
  • 771a5f28ff implement a bunch of enums krawieck 2020-08-11 19:29:56 +0200
  • 5971a947d6 Add `SearchType` and implement it krawieck 2020-08-11 19:04:03 +0200
  • da988f74bd Change `PostType` to `PostListingType` krawieck 2020-08-11 19:03:24 +0200
  • d646a83881 disabled undocumented members lint and added effective dart badge shilangyu 2020-08-10 23:27:35 +0200
  • 6436244b66 Add comments to properties based on web docs krawieck 2020-08-11 02:43:03 +0200
  • 0d42fd44ac Update pubspec krawieck 2020-08-11 02:42:40 +0200
  • bfae0ef57d Implement `getPosts` krawieck 2020-08-11 02:42:23 +0200
  • 13522248d4 Add exports krawieck 2020-08-11 00:10:17 +0200
  • a6a33f1395
    Merge pull request #9 from krawieck/disable-api-docs-lint #10 Filip Krawczyk 2020-08-10 23:33:23 +0200
  • 01dd0c46e4 disabled undocumented members lint and added effective dart badge #9 shilangyu 2020-08-10 23:27:35 +0200
  • 9deb17edc7 Add `PostType` and `SortType` krawieck 2020-08-10 23:07:13 +0200
  • f4206be302 Make imports safer krawieck 2020-08-10 19:49:19 +0200
  • b5a9d72fb6 Add some more return types krawieck 2020-08-10 19:48:26 +0200
  • c40c72eeac Add even MORE return types! krawieck 2020-08-10 19:47:44 +0200
  • c6361291aa Make import safer krawieck 2020-08-10 19:39:53 +0200
  • 06230c2248 Autoformat krawieck 2020-08-10 19:25:13 +0200
  • 5902cd8f6f Add codegen files krawieck 2020-08-10 19:23:21 +0200
  • 29dd4dcc35 Add missing import krawieck 2020-08-10 19:23:03 +0200
  • 51cc332f7c Added FullPost, Search, and UserDetails #1 shilangyu 2020-08-10 14:47:05 +0000
  • e0a149f688 added Category shilangyu 2020-08-10 14:07:00 +0000
  • cf59f9f2ae added UserMention and Site views shilangyu 2020-08-10 12:39:22 +0000
  • 2af364abeb fixed import shilangyu 2020-08-10 12:36:30 +0000
  • 101c7c4afc made captcha json-serializable shilangyu 2020-08-10 12:22:28 +0000
  • 3aa92f695d added CommunityModerator and CommunityFollower views shilangyu 2020-08-10 11:52:42 +0000
  • f0bfdba132 Updated placement of `Captcha` in filesystem krawieck 2020-08-10 00:42:31 +0200
  • f85b91bb49 removed unnecesairy duplication krawieck 2020-08-10 00:34:50 +0200
  • 413b4bef30 Add `ReplyView` krawieck 2020-08-10 00:01:10 +0200
  • ca9759db47 Add more return types krawieck 2020-08-09 23:32:42 +0200
  • 8ab016076a Add `Captcha` class and return type krawieck 2020-08-09 23:24:06 +0200
  • 9c101868a3 stfu mr linter krawieck 2020-08-09 23:20:21 +0200
  • 1b34add11e Add `CommunityView` tests krawieck 2020-08-09 23:09:48 +0200
  • 039fd6e6a0 Autoformat krawieck 2020-08-09 23:03:44 +0200
  • 4594632f9a Add `UserView` tests krawieck 2020-08-09 23:01:53 +0200
  • 5adee282b6 shuffled tests around krawieck 2020-08-09 22:52:17 +0200
  • 03c2669ad3 Add PostView test krawieck 2020-08-09 21:43:08 +0200
  • 6120cb58f7 Add tests for CommentView krawieck 2020-08-09 21:32:58 +0200
  • 33a00e0628 Update codegen files krawieck 2020-08-09 21:17:22 +0200
  • 047274f722 Add codegen files krawieck 2020-08-09 21:15:26 +0200
  • 8dee300ffa Add constructor (+ autoformat) krawieck 2020-08-09 21:15:05 +0200
  • 4de70c8c24 added PrivateMessage and Reply views shilangyu 2020-08-09 18:14:06 +0000
  • 79b469f081 Merge branch 'http-client' of https://github.com/krawieck/lemmur into http-client krawieck 2020-08-09 13:22:23 +0200
  • d3744476de Merge branch 'http-client' of ssh://github.com/krawieck/lemmur into http-client shilangyu 2020-08-09 13:19:18 +0000
  • 63fed075ed Added community and user views shilangyu 2020-08-09 13:19:13 +0000
  • fd8ca3caff let's start testing! krawieck 2020-08-09 13:20:15 +0200
  • 1e84b6057b removed `Date.tryParse` cuz it's not what we thought it was krawieck 2020-08-09 13:17:32 +0200
  • 8f0a2b14b7 Update return types krawieck 2020-08-09 00:27:13 +0200
  • 8ff51b4aec
    Merge pull request #8 from krawieck/mapping_objects Filip Krawczyk 2020-08-08 23:54:24 +0200
  • 7d902ce352 Update pubspec.lock #8 krawieck 2020-08-08 23:53:04 +0200
  • 8cc0591dfa Add codegen files krawieck 2020-08-08 23:51:17 +0200
  • f4f6ddd8fe added missing commas and removed codegen files shilangyu 2020-08-08 23:46:27 +0000
  • b829b30593 models cleanup shilangyu 2020-08-08 23:24:25 +0000
  • 1515c6f397 Add Vote enum for upvotes krawieck 2020-08-08 23:24:34 +0200
  • 091070726e Change methods to be top level with names based on OP codes. classes changed to extensions of `V1` class krawieck 2020-08-06 22:06:53 +0200